03

Three separate scopes

Do not merge the three scopes

Regular reference

Meihua Lake Scenic Area

Hours
09:00–17:30
Telephone
03-9617267

The scenic area, leisure-agriculture area and boat operation are separate scopes; their hours and telephone numbers cannot be merged.

Regular reference

Meihua Lake Leisure Agriculture Area

Hours
06:00–00:00
Telephone
03-9615576

The scenic area, leisure-agriculture area and boat operation are separate scopes; their hours and telephone numbers cannot be merged.

Operator-dependent

Meihua Lake boat operation

Hours
09:00–17:00
Telephone
03-9612888

The township page currently lists 09:00–17:00, about 2.5 km, about 15 minutes, NT$75 full and NT$35 half fare; confirm departures, loading and suspension rules that day.

09

Lake ecology

Official records include night herons, mandarin ducks, ducks, squirrels and Taiwan macaques; they may be observed but are never guaranteed. Do not chase, approach or feed wildlife. Travel slowly on shared roads and keep piers, shops and vehicle paths clear.
